Top 5 Air Travel Apps Performance in Russia, Q4 2025
Explore the performance trends of the top air travel apps in Russia during Q4 2025, highlighting downloads, revenue, and active users.
In the fourth quarter of 2025, the top air travel apps in Russia showed varied performance across downloads, revenue, and active users. Data, sourced from Sensor Tower, provides a detailed look into these trends.
Aviasales — Book cheap flights experienced fluctuations in weekly downloads, starting at around 68K and closing the quarter at approximately 45K. Weekly revenue peaked at $79 in early November, while active users saw a decline from 3M to 2.5M by the end of December.
Flightradar24 | Flight Tracker maintained a steady weekly revenue, peaking at $5.5K in the last week of December. Downloads saw a significant rise in late December, reaching 20K, while active users fluctuated between 400K and 480K.
Kupibilet — cheap tickets showed consistent download numbers, starting at 12K and ending at 10K in December. Active users increased throughout the quarter, peaking at 144K in late November.
AeroSell - Cheap Flights Avia saw a spike in downloads in mid-October, reaching 24K, with a consistent number of active users fluctuating around 35K to 45K.
Авиабилеты дешево на Туту ру started strong with downloads around 18K, but saw a dip to 3.6K in early December, recovering slightly to 6K by the end of the quarter. Active users decreased from 52K to 33K over the same period.
